ENTRAVISION COMMUNICATIONS CORPORATION TO ISSUE $200 MILLION SENIOR SUBORDINATED
NOTES

Santa Monica, CA, March 5, 2002 - Entravision Communications Corporation (NYSE:
EVC) today announced that it proposes to make an offering of an aggregate
principal amount of $200 million of Senior Subordinated Notes due 2009. The
notes will be unsecured senior subordinated indebtedness and will be guaranteed
by certain of Entravision's domestic subsidiaries. Entravision intends to use
the net proceeds from the sale of the notes, plus cash on hand, to repay the
term loan under its bank credit facility.

The notes will be sold to qualified institutional buyers in reliance on Rule
144A and outside the United States in reliance on Regulation S under the
Securities Act of 1933. The offering of the notes will not be registered under
the Securities Act and may not be offered or sold in the United States absent
registration or an applicable exemption from registration requirements.
